Engineering Technician

This position involves extensive field work and travel to locations within Western Canada . Training associated with cathodic protection (CP) and the corrosion engineering field in general will be provided to the successful candidate. Ideal candidates will have:

  • Engineering Degree or Technical Diploma
    • Preferable in: Metallurgy / Materials, Mechanical, or Electrical / Electronics

· Excellent organizational skills.

· Strong oral and written communication skills; ability to compile data and prepare reports

  • Working knowledge of computers (MS Word, Excel and Access)
  • Technical Association Registration, NACE certification and/or related professional experience would be considered an asset
  • Canadian citizenship or permanent residency

CC Technologies Canada, Ltd. offers a competitive salary and benefits package, including medical, life and disability insurance, Group RRSP, paid vacation and holidays as well as training opportunities.
